The Digital Revolution: Empowering My Minimalist and Mindful Lifestyle

Living solo teaches you many things - how to manage your time, how to be your own cheerleader, and most of all, how to filter what truly matters. I’m an extreme when it comes to filtering out the unwanted. Detoxing my body, decluttering my wardrobe, and letting go of toxic people who drain my energy is like breathing fresh air for me. Back in my days when I had quit my job to live in the Himalayas, I embraced a minimalist lifestyle. Living out of my car was an absolute blast, and I loved the freedom of location-independence. Since then I’ve been trying to strike a right balance between minimalism and content. And digitisation became the quiet but powerful partner that helped me lean into a lifestyle that’s both minimal and deeply intentional.
Minimalism for me isn’t just about owning less—it’s about doing more with less clutter in my space, schedule, and mind. And the right digital tools, used consciously, have played a big role in this shift.

​Home: A Space That Breathes

When you live solo, every inch of your space speaks to your mindset. I’ve consciously chosen functional furniture, smart storage, and minimal décor. Digital platforms are my go-to for finding the latest tech for furniture, kitchen gadgets, and appliances. No more running around for choices!
Maintenance and cleaning services are also a tap away. Scheduling deep cleans or handyman visits used to feel like a chore, now it’s just a few swipes. My home feels like a sanctuary—not a list of unfinished tasks.

Food & Groceries: Streamlined, Zero Waste

I used to buy in bulk, cook in excess, and let half of it go unused. But using grocery apps changed the way I shop. I now plan small, weekly batches instead of monthly hauls. I only order what I need for the next three to four days, reducing both food waste and fridge clutter.
What I love most is the real-time stock updates and smart reordering. I can see what’s running low and schedule just that, no unnecessary wandering down supermarket aisles.
Apps also offer in-built spend trackers, so I’ve become more conscious of how much I actually spend on staples vs indulgences. Cooking is now more thoughtful, less wasteful, and somehow, more joyful.

Fashion: Curating, Not Collecting

There was a time when sale alerts gave me a thrill. Now, they feel like noise. I’ve replaced impulse buying with wishlisting—a small habit that changed my shopping mindset. Instead of buying instantly, I bookmark items I like, and revisit them after a few days. Most times, I realize I didn’t really need them.
Digitally, I now track what’s already in my wardrobe. It helps me avoid duplicates, spot gaps, and keep a balanced capsule closet. I don’t chase trends—I curate timeless, quality pieces. I feel lighter when getting dressed, and somehow, more confident.

Self-Care & Wellness: Simplified, but Sacred

Digital wellness tools help me turn self-care into a rhythm, not a ritual I forget. I schedule monthly massages and salon services from digital platforms - one tap, and I’m set. The auto-reminder feature saves me from last-minute bookings and stress.
With the advent of luxury self-care products available online, I I can now create a spa-like ambience right in my own bedroom. I no longer feel the need to escape to the Himalayas for peace and relaxation. My routines are now simpler, more rooted, and aligned with how I feel—not what the algorithm says I should do.

Commute & Movement: Light, On-Demand

I own a compact i10 that’s just right for city living - easy to maneuver, park, and maintain. But what truly makes my urban commute lighter is how digitisation enhances every aspect of car ownership.
With just a few taps, I can schedule car servicing and car washes at my doorstep, often while I’m working from home or enjoying a quiet coffee. Finding parking in crowded city zones used to be a hassle, but now apps help me locate nearby spots, even in unfamiliar areas.
FASTag integration has simplified toll and parking payments, eliminating the need for cash or waiting in queues. And thanks to digital document storage apps, I no longer scramble for my car insurance, PUC or registration - everything I need travels with me, safely tucked in my phone.
On days when I feel too drained to drive or simply want a break from navigating traffic, I turn to ride-hailing apps - a gentle backup plan that gives me flexibility without overloading my day.
Digitisation, in this sense, doesn’t replace the joy of owning my car—it simply makes it lighter, smarter, and more intentional.

Money & Mindfulness: Clarity Over Complexity

One of the biggest shifts has been tracking my spending digitally. I know exactly where my money goes every month. FinTech Apps have helped me plan my spends - not out of restriction, but as a reflection of my values.
Subscriptions, renewals, offers, investments - all neatly visible in dashboards. No surprise bills. This financial clarity has helped me overcome my anxiety about having enough balance in my account to pay my bills on time. The timely reminders have prevented me from receiving unwanted pestering from institutions to pay my bills in advance. I’ve learned to spend not for convenience or validation, but for meaning.


More Than Minimal: A Lifestyle of Intentional Abundance

Minimalism doesn’t mean lack. It means space - to breathe, to think, to enjoy. Digitisation hasn’t made me dependent, it’s made me deliberate.
Every app I use now serves a purpose. They don’t add noise; they create room. Room for rest, for clarity, for doing the things that truly add value to my life.
Living solo, I’ve learned that simplicity doesn’t come from giving up everything. It comes from choosing just enough, and letting go of the rest—with ease, not guilt. And for that, I have digitisation to thank.
